package org.apache.uima.collection.impl.cpm.utils;
import org.apache.uima.UIMAFramework;
import org.apache.uima.internal.util.JavaTimer;
import org.apache.uima.resource.ResourceInitializationException;
import org.apache.uima.util.Level;
import org.apache.uima.util.UimaTimer;
/**
* Creates an instance of UimaTimer.
*/
public class TimerFactory {
/** The timer. */
private static UimaTimer timer = null;
/**
* Instantiate UimaTimer object from a given class.
*
* @param aClassName -
* UimaTimer implemetation class
*/
public TimerFactory(String aClassName) {
try {
initialize(aClassName);
} catch (Exception e) {
if (UIMAFramework.getLogger().isLoggable(Level.CONFIG)) {
UIMAFramework.getLogger(TimerFactory.class).logrb(Level.CONFIG,
TimerFactory.class.getName(), "initialize", CPMUtils.CPM_LOG_RESOURCE_BUNDLE,
"UIMA_CPM_java_timer__CONFIG", new Object[] { Thread.currentThread().getName() });
}
timer = new JavaTimer();
}
}
/**
* Returns instance of {@link UimaTimer}.
*
* @return UimaTimer instance
*/
public static UimaTimer getTimer() {
if (timer == null) {
if (UIMAFramework.getLogger().isLoggable(Level.CONFIG)) {
UIMAFramework.getLogger(TimerFactory.class).logrb(Level.CONFIG,
TimerFactory.class.getName(), "initialize", CPMUtils.CPM_LOG_RESOURCE_BUNDLE,
"UIMA_CPM_java_timer__CONFIG", new Object[] { Thread.currentThread().getName() });
}
timer = new JavaTimer();
}
return timer;
}
/**
* Instantiates dynamically a UimaTimer object.
*
* @param aClassName -
* class implementing UimaTimer
* @throws ResourceInitializationException -
*/
private void initialize(String aClassName) throws ResourceInitializationException {
if (aClassName != null) {
try {
Class currentClass = Class.forName(aClassName);
Object anObject = currentClass.newInstance();
if (anObject instanceof UimaTimer) {
timer = (UimaTimer) anObject;
if (UIMAFramework.getLogger().isLoggable(Level.CONFIG)) {
UIMAFramework.getLogger(TimerFactory.class).logrb(Level.CONFIG,
TimerFactory.class.getName(), "initialize", CPMUtils.CPM_LOG_RESOURCE_BUNDLE,
"UIMA_CPM_show_timer_class__CONFIG",
new Object[] { Thread.currentThread().getName(), timer.getClass().getName() });
}
return;
}
} catch (ClassNotFoundException e) {
throw new ResourceInitializationException(ResourceInitializationException.CLASS_NOT_FOUND,
new Object[] { aClassName, "CPE" }, e);
} catch (IllegalAccessException e) {
throw new ResourceInitializationException(
ResourceInitializationException.COULD_NOT_INSTANTIATE, new Object[] { aClassName,
"CPE" }, e);
} catch (InstantiationException e) {
throw new ResourceInitializationException(
ResourceInitializationException.COULD_NOT_INSTANTIATE, new Object[] { aClassName,
"CPE" }, e);
}
if (UIMAFramework.getLogger().isLoggable(Level.CONFIG)) {
UIMAFramework.getLogger(TimerFactory.class).logrb(Level.CONFIG,
TimerFactory.class.getName(), "initialize", CPMUtils.CPM_LOG_RESOURCE_BUNDLE,
"UIMA_CPM_java_timer__CONFIG", new Object[] { Thread.currentThread().getName() });
}
timer = new JavaTimer();
}
}
}
